Key Features
- Ultra-High Precision Processing
- Cutting Accuracy: Achieves micron-level precision (±0.03 mm) with high-brightness fiber lasers (1–6 kW), ideal for intricate patterns, micro-perforations, and complex contours in stainless steel strips (0.1–8 mm thickness).
- Welding Consistency: Produces spatter-free, seamless welds with minimal heat-affected zone (HAZ), preserving the corrosion resistance and structural integrity of stainless steel (e.g., 304, 316 grades).
- Non-Contact Technology
- Eliminates mechanical stress and tool wear, preventing deformation, burrs, or micro-cracks in thin or polished stainless steel strips.
- Laser welding avoids filler materials, ensuring clean, oxidation-resistant joints critical for hygienic or decorative applications.
- Material Versatility
- Processes austenitic, ferritic, and duplex stainless steels, including coated or brushed finishes (e.g., No. 4, mirror polish).
- Handles varying thicknesses (0.1–10 mm) without compromising edge quality or weld strength.
- Smart Automation Integration
- Robotic Arms and Conveyor Systems: Enable 24/7 automated production with real-time adjustments for strip alignment and feed speed.
- AI-powered nesting software optimizes material utilization, reducing scrap rates by up to 25%.
- Eco-Friendly and Safe Design
- Fully enclosed workstations with HEPA filtration and fume extraction systems ensure compliance with ISO 13849 and OSHA standards.
- Energy-efficient fiber lasers reduce power consumption by 35% compared to CO₂ lasers.

Key Applications
- Medical and Pharmaceutical Equipment
- Cutting and welding stainless steel strips for surgical tools, sterilization trays, and MRI machine components with ultra-clean finishes.
- Food Processing and Packaging
- Fabricating conveyor belts, hygienic seals, and storage tanks requiring corrosion resistance and smooth surfaces.
- Architectural and Interior Design
- Precision cutting of decorative strips for elevator panels, handrails, and façade cladding with intricate patterns.
- Automotive and Transportation
- Manufacturing exhaust systems, trim components, and EV battery enclosures from high-grade stainless steel.
- Electronics and Consumer Goods
- Producing EMI shielding, watch bands, and kitchenware with polished, scratch-resistant surfaces.
